rest_delete_{$this->taxonomy}

動作鉤子
do_action( "rest_delete_{$this->taxonomy}", $term, $response, $request )
引數
  • (WP_Term) $term The deleted term.
    Required:
  • (WP_REST_Response) $response The response data.
    Required:
  • (WP_REST_Request) $request The request sent to the API.
    Required:
定義位置
相關勾子
rest_insert_this-taxonomyrest_prepare_this-taxonomyrest_delete_revisiondelete_term_taxonomyrest_after_insert_this-taxonomy
相關方法
rest_get_route_for_taxonomy_itemsget_taxonomydelete_optionregister_taxonomyis_taxonomyget_the_taxonomies
引入
4.7.0
棄用
-

rest_delete_{$this->taxonomy} – 與第一個鉤子類似,這個鉤子在請求刪除指定分類法的一個術語時被呼叫。鉤子名稱中的{$this->taxonomy}部分是根據被刪除的分類法動態生成的,所以它可以是rest_delete_category、rest_delete_tag等。開發者可以使用這個鉤子來修改請求資料,或者在刪除這個型別的術語時執行額外的操作。

通過REST API刪除單個術語後觸發。

鉤子名稱的動態部分$this->taxonomy,指的是分類slug。

可能的鉤子名稱包括:

  • rest_delete_category
  • rest_delete_post_tag
Plain text
Copy to clipboard
Open code in new window
EnlighterJS 3 Syntax Highlighter
do_action( "rest_delete_{$this->taxonomy}", $term, $response, $request );
do_action( "rest_delete_{$this->taxonomy}", $term, $response, $request );
do_action( "rest_delete_{$this->taxonomy}", $term, $response, $request );

常見問題

FAQs
檢視更多 >